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9029 1849530866 62025
8555 533
8555 533
7690001 7030873285 4464166
All about undefined
Interested in learning more?
8555 533
7690001 7030873285 4464166
See more
88064990 4632
1103 33660495 28717204
See more
47568190248 0175
7573 620053 77314939 8517509
See more